Full description

PSPC, on behalf of Correctional Services Canada, has a requirement for consultant services for options analysis for a new health centre at Springhill Institution, Springhill, Nova Scotia.
Invited Firms: This is an RFP against Supply Arrangement E0225-152290 Architecture and Interior Design. The invited firms qualified under this SA are: Architecture49; Boyd R. Algee Architect; DFS; FABRIQ Architecture; Fowler Bauld & Mitchell; Republic Architecture; and Stantec Architecture.
Debrief: Bidders may request a debriefing on the results of the bid solicitation. Bidders should make the request to the Contracting Authority within 15 working days from receipt of notification that their bid was unsuccessful. The RFP issuing office is: Atlantic Region Acquisitions, 1713 Bedford Row, Halifax, NS B3J 1T3. This office provides services in English. Proposals may be submitted in either official language of Canada. Reference the solicitation for further details.
